The key to writing a story synopsis is to be clear and concise. Highlight the most important elements - the protagonist's goal, the obstacles they face, and the ultimate outcome. Make sure it gives a good sense of the story's overall arc and theme.

To write a short story synopsis, think about the main idea and the most important moments. Describe them in a logical sequence. Like, 'A man loses his job and decides to start his own business, encountering obstacles but ultimately finding success.' Make sure to give a sense of the story's overall tone and message.
